CVE-2021-0881

CVE-2021-0881 describes an integer overflow in the PowerVR kernel driver component PVRSRVBridgeRGXKickCDM that occurs due to a missing size check. This can enable out-of-bounds heap access and lead to local escalation of privilege without extra execution privileges or user interaction. The vulner...
